User account optionally configured by
an administrator to be able to access
devices connected to the ports of the
AlterPath OnSite. Regular users can
access only those devices that are
connected to ports which they have
permission to access. Users with
permission to access ports or perform
certain other tasks through the OnSite
are referred to as “authorized users.”
Authorized remote users can access
either KVM or serial ports through the
Web Manager, and authorized local
users can access only KVM ports
through the OSD. Default Access
Privileges for generic users are: No
access. Administrators must configure
access to ports for any added users.
Note:If an administrator assigns a
regular user to the “admin” group, that
user becomes an administrative user
who can also perform the same
administrative functions on the Web
Manager as the “admin” user, as
described above.
